Inheritance describes the process and rights a person has to various types of property upon the death of a spouse or relative. In order for man kind to be saved and inherit heaven Jesus had to die. But, there are laws that are established to which gives rights for people to the inheritance of heaven, and one of those laws is the faith law. One has to have a certain type of faith that is classified as the saving faith to have rights to heaven. One can have the measure of faith that heals, prospers, calls out miracles, but in order to inherit heaven he/she needs to have the saving faith. The jailor in Acts 16 after Paul and Silas were beaten and thrown into jail developed the saving faith and believed in Jesus Christ along with his family and were saved (v34).  Paul speaks about this saving faith that is one of the key component to having rights to the inheritance in Colossians 2:12, when he says “buried with him in baptism, wherein also ye are risen with him through the faith of the operation of God, who hath raised him from the dead”. The inheritance can be taken away if one does not abide within the rules to inherit.

Romans 4:13-16

13 For the promise, that he should be the heir of the world, was not to Abraham, or to his seed, through the law, but through the righteousness of faith. 14 For if they which are of the law be heirs, faith is made void, and the promise made of none effect: 15 because the law worketh wrath: for where no law is, there is no transgression. 16 Therefore it is of faith, that it might be by grace; to the end the promise might be sure to all the seed; not to that only which is of the law, but to that also which is of the faith of Abraham; who is the father of us all,

Abraham was made a promise that he would be an heir of the world if he kept the faith; of which he did. He believed God and his inheritance was secured; his seed inherited the lands they touched. Now, our inheritance is not earthly, but it does impact our earthly lives and can be lost; though it is guaranteed by God (Eph1:13-14) to them that are his. But, a special interest has to be placed on that inheritance; an opening of our eyes, otherwise it will slip away (Eph1:18). The idea nowadays that by grace alone you are saved is incorrect, because before grace there has come faith (R.4:16, Eph2:8). In order to receive the grace of God one needs to have saving faith it is part of the inheritance of the kingdom.
